< prev index next >

src/hotspot/share/runtime/vmStructs.cpp

Print this page

        

@@ -128,10 +128,11 @@
 #include "opto/optoreg.hpp"
 #include "opto/parse.hpp"
 #include "opto/phaseX.hpp"
 #include "opto/regalloc.hpp"
 #include "opto/rootnode.hpp"
+#include "opto/signum.hpp"
 #include "opto/subnode.hpp"
 #include "opto/vectornode.hpp"
 #endif // COMPILER2
 
 // Note: the cross-product of (c1, c2, product, nonproduct, ...),

@@ -1856,10 +1857,13 @@
   declare_c2_type(OverflowAddLNode, OverflowLNode)                        \
   declare_c2_type(OverflowSubLNode, OverflowLNode)                        \
   declare_c2_type(OverflowMulLNode, OverflowLNode)                        \
   declare_c2_type(FmaDNode, Node)                                         \
   declare_c2_type(FmaFNode, Node)                                         \
+  declare_c2_type(SignumNode, Node)                                       \
+  declare_c2_type(SignumDNode, SignumNode)                                \
+  declare_c2_type(SignumFNode, SignumNode)                                \
                                                                           \
   /*********************/                                                 \
   /* Adapter Blob Entries */                                              \
   /*********************/                                                 \
   declare_toplevel_type(AdapterHandlerEntry)                              \
< prev index next >